
Rosacea
Red blood vessels on the face, especially on the cheeks and nose, can be unsightly. As we age, the number of blood vessels increases.
The couperose treatment works as follows: With a laser handpiece, green light or light of 540-950 nm is absorbed by the red blood cells. This causes the blood vessels to close off and disappear.
Practical information
-
The rosacea treatment takes about 20 minutes. Generally, 2 to 3 treatments are needed.
-
Preparation: It is important that your skin is not overexposed to the sun, so avoid sun exposure or tanning beds before the treatment. Also, do not use self-tanning products.
-
After the treatment, you may experience slight redness or swelling, especially around the eyes. This usually only lasts a few hours but can last up to 2 days after the treatment. You may wear make-up.
-
It is best to avoid hot baths or saunas.
